2014-02-02 2 views
2

Недавно после обновления до Resharper 8.1 я столкнулся с очень странной ошибкой, которая заставляет визуальную студию удалять (или объединять две последовательные строки) каждый раз, когда я нажимаю кнопку запуска отладки. Я знал, что это вызвано Resharper, потому что я попытался отключить его, и проблема просто исчезла. Поэтому я сразу же сбросил все настройки Resharper без везения !.Resharper Strange Behavior

Пример:

UpdateData1(); 
UpdateData2(); 

Становится

UpdateData1();UpdateData2(); 
+0

[. Вы не только один, по-видимому] (http://stackoverflow.com/questions/9860627/visual-studio-removes-line-break-on- start) Некоторые предложения в этом сообщении и ссылка на пост поддержки JetBrains, но там нет реального ответа. –

+0

Могу ли я вернуться на 8.0 или что? –

+0

проблема также в том, что это не всегда происходит, поэтому они даже не могут ее исправить! –

ответ

0

Я имел exact problem. я использую VS2013, ReSharper 10.0.2 и DevExpress компоненты.

Решение освобождает файл licences.licx. Я использую этот скомпилированный скрипт на VS0213:

break>$(ProjectDir)\Properties\licenses.licx 
+0

У меня такая же проблема, и ваше решение не работает. Я использую VS2015 (версия 14.0.25424.00 Update 3), ReSharper 10.0.2 и DevExpress v16.1.5. Любой способ решить это? – vcRobe

+0

Через некоторое время я понял это также. Я не мог заставить его работать. К сожалению, я отключил ReSharper. Я подозреваю, что это зависит от DevEx Patch. @vcRobe вы используете патч DevEx? –

+0

Да, я использую патч DevEx. Я тестирую DevExpress, но одного месяца недостаточно для выполнения всех необходимых тестов. И я также понял, что проблема возникает после установки DevEx – vcRobe